UNITED STATES v. KARNUTH


28 F.2d 281 (1928)

UNITED STATES ex rel. SOGOLOW et ux. v. KARNUTH, District Director of Immigration.

District Court, W. D. New York.

August 25, 1928.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Botsford, Mitchell, Albro & Weber, of Buffalo, N. Y., for relators.

Richard H. Templeton, U. S. Atty., of Buffalo, N. Y. (Richard A. Grimm, Asst. U. S. Atty., of Buffalo, N. Y., of counsel), for respondent.


HAZEL, District Judge.

Relators, husband and wife, subjects of Russia, were denied admission to the United States by the Special Board of Inquiry on the ground that they were not possessed of an unexpired consular visa.
